person Tia Zanella
calendar_add_on Created February 1, 2026
update Updated April 5, 2026
Share
download Download MD

roadmap 2026

OSIRIS ist ein Open Standard und ein statisches Snapshot-Format, um Infrastrukturressourcen und ihre topologischen Beziehungen zu einem bestimmten Zeitpunkt zu beschreiben. Diese Roadmap konzentriert sich zunächst darauf, ein nutzbares MVP bereitzustellen (spec + website) und anschließend Tooling und Producer zu entwickeln, die OSIRIS-Dokumente erzeugen und validieren.

Leitende Prioritäten

  • Stabilität mit spec-first: v1.0 kohärent halten und sie mithilfe von SemVer und den Kompatibilitätsregeln der Spezifikation weiterentwickeln.
  • Producer/Consumer-Trennung: Producer (source > OSIRIS) und Consumer/Tooling (OSIRIS > validation/usage) aufbauen, um die Integrationskomplexität zu reduzieren.
  • Zuerst Domänen im Scope: Kern-IT-Domänen priorisieren (Hyperscaler, Public-Cloud-Anbieter, Netzwerk, Compute, Storage, Virtualisierung) mit anfänglicher OT-Unterstützung dort, wo Integration wichtig ist.

Lieferplan 2026

ERSTES MVP (abgeschlossen)

Dokumentation, Spezifikation und Website

  • OSIRIS-v1.0-Spezifikation veröffentlicht unter /spec/v1.0
  • Schema-Referenz und Validierungsleitfaden (JSON Schema + Regeln)
  • Öffentliche Beispielbibliothek (IT + OT), abgestimmt auf v1.0
  • Zentrale Community-Seiten (Verhaltenskodex, Governance, Maintainer)

OSIRIS ist für Austausch-Szenarien wie Dokumentation, Diagramme, Inventare und Audit-Nachweise konzipiert.

Q1-Q2 2026 (abgeschlossen)

Toolbox und erste Producer

  • OSIRIS Toolbox (initial): CLI + VS Code-Erweiterung + Validatoren + SDK-Basis
  • Validierung: Prüfungen der Stufe 1 (Schema) und Stufe 2 (Semantik) als primärer Workflow
  • Cisco producer (initial): OSIRIS-Dokumente aus Cisco-Netzwerkquellen erzeugen
  • Microsoft Azure (initial): OSIRIS-Dokumente aus Microsoft-Azure-Subscriptions und ihren Ressourcen erzeugen

Producer und Consumer haben in OSIRIS klar definierte Verantwortlichkeiten, und Validierung ist eine zentrale Interoperabilitätsanforderung.

Q3 2026

AWS- und GCP-Producer

  • AWS producer: OSIRIS-Dokumente aus AWS-Inventaren/Topologiequellen erzeugen
  • GCP producer: OSIRIS-Dokumente aus GCP-Inventaren/Topologiequellen erzeugen
  • Toolbox-Verbesserungen auf Basis realer Producer-Ausgaben (Diff-/Merge-Workflows, Reporting)

OSIRIS ermöglicht plattformübergreifende Topologie-Snapshots und Vergleiche über die Zeit durch die Verwendung stabiler IDs und expliziter Beziehungen.

Q4 2026

On-Prem- und Cloudflare-Producer

  • On-Prem-Producer für UniFi, Arista und Nokia: OSIRIS-Dokumente aus UniFi-, Arista- und Nokia-Netzwerkressourcen erzeugen
  • Cloudflare producer: OSIRIS-Dokumente aus Cloudflare-Inventaren/Topologiequellen erzeugen
  • Weitere Beispiele aus realen Producer-Läufen abgeleitet (Referenz-Snapshots)

Consumer müssen vorwärtskompatibel bleiben, indem sie unbekannte Felder/Typen/Namespaces akzeptieren und Erweiterungen beibehalten.

Querschnittsarbeit über das Jahr 2026 hinweg

verified Stärkung der Interoperabilität

  • Kompatibilitätstests über v1.x-Releases hinweg (v1.0-Dokumente innerhalb von v1.x gültig halten)
  • Klare Markierungen für Veraltungen und Migrationsleitfäden bei Bedarf

OSIRIS definiert SemVer, Regeln für Vorwärtskompatibilität und einen Lebenszyklus für Veraltungen.

extension Hygiene des Erweiterungsökosystems

  • Namespace-Leitlinien und empfohlene Muster für Vendor-/Org-Erweiterungen dokumentieren
  • „zuerst Standardtypen“ fördern, Erweiterungen nur bei Bedarf

Producer sollten Standardtypen bevorzugen und Erweiterungen für anbieterspezifische/organisationsspezifische Daten verwenden.

Wie Sie die Roadmap beeinflussen können

Wenn Sie Änderungen vorschlagen möchten (neue Typen, neue Producer, Klarstellungen), beteiligen Sie sich an der Diskussion mit:

Diskutieren
Sie den Anwendungsfall
Implementieren
Sie ein minimales Beispiel
Prüfen
Sie, warum bestehende Typen/Felder unzureichend sind

Beteiligen Sie sich an der Community zur Diskussion.

forum

Roadmap-Updates

Diese Seite wird überarbeitet, sobald Meilensteine abgeschlossen sind und die Prioritäten der Community klarer werden.
edit_note

Help improve this page

Found an issue or want to contribute? Open an issue.